Effect of clustering on cage tilapia value chain performance in Lake Victoria, Kenya

Kenya’s cage tilapia value chain is facing significant challenges that threaten its sustainability and the well-being of those who depend on it. The most pressing issues include high cost of feeds and inadequate infrastructure. This study evaluates the effect of clustering on the cage tilapia value chain performance in Lake Victoria, Kenya, hypothesizing that a higher Clustering Index (CI) enhances gross margins performance of the sector. Using cross-sectional data from 369 respondents across five riparian counties, Principal Component Analysis (PCA) and Generalized Linear Models (GLM) were applied. Results show a significant positive effect of clustering (CI: 0.2–0.8) on gross margins (β = 0.286, p < 0.001), with Homa Bay and Kisumu outperforming Busia by 20%. Clustering is associated with reduced feed delivery time by 20% through bulk purchasing, offering a pathway to offset costs. These findings provide actionable insights for policymakers to enhance aquaculture sustainability and competitiveness, aligning with Sustainable Development Goal (SDG) 2 and 8.
